Ingredients you’ll need

For the exact measurements, please refer to the printable recipe card at the bottom of this post. 

  • Box of spice cake mix - yes you are reading that right! Using a box mix for a great flavor shortcut! In a pinch you can use a yellow cake mix with a teaspoon of pumpkin spice.
  • Canned pumpkin puree - be sure to get a can of pumpkin puree and not pumpkin pie filling.
  • Eggs - to add richness and helps the bread rise.
  • Oil - use corn or canola oil.
  • Chocolate chips - this time I used a combination of mini chocolate chips and dark chocolate. Use your favorite!
  • Chopped walnuts - the nuts are optional, but I think they really add great texture to this quick bread.

Step-by-step instructions

This is an overview of the instructions for the Pumpkin Bread with Cake Mix Recipe. For the complete directions just scroll down to the bottom!

  1. Preheat the oven to 350 degrees.
  2. Chop the nuts, prepare the baking pan.
  3. Mix all of the ingredients together until just combined.
  4. Pour into loaf pan.
  5. Place in preheated oven. Bake for 45-50 minutes until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.

Frequently asked questions (FAQ’s)

Do you refrigerate pumpkin bread?

Yes, you'll want to refrigerate it to extend the shelf life. If you're going to gobble it down that first day, no problem! It will last on the counter just a couple of days.

How do you know when pumpkin bread is done?

Test it with a toothpick - insert it into the center of the loaf, if it comes out clean, it's done!

What can I add to pumpkin bread?

Walnuts, almonds, hazelnuts or pecans are a great addition. You can sprinkle the top with toasted pumpkin seeds before baking, too - yum!
Slather sour cream frosting over the top of the loaf after it cools - THAT will take it to the next level!

How do you keep pumpkin bread moist?

The oil in this recipe really helps keep this loaf moist. After it's baked, just be sure to wrap it well. That will keep it from drying out.

Deb’s tips for the perfect dish

If you can't find a spice cake mix, use a yellow or a white cake mix, adding a teaspoon of pumpkin pie spice.

  • Be sure to spray the pan well with non-stick cooking spray prior to adding the dough. That will make it a lot easier to get out of the pan.
  • After removing the chocolate chip pumpkin bread from the oven, allow it to rest 10 minutes. Then run a knife around the edges, invert it and the loaf will slip right out.
  • Set the loaf on a cooling rack and allow it to cool completely before slicing.

How to store leftovers

Refrigerate - For longer shelf life, wrap it in plastic and then foil. Refrigerated it will last 5-7 days.

Freeze - up to 3 months.

Chocolate Chip Pumpkin Bread Recipe

An easy quick bread is packed with tons of chocolate chips, nuts and loads of pumpkin flavor. It's super moist and easy to make so delicious!

Prep Time10 minutes mins
Cook Time45 minutes mins
Total Time55 minutes mins
Course: Dessert
Cuisine: American
Servings: 12 servings
Calories: 344kcal
Author: Deb Clark
Cost: $10

Ingredients

  • 1 box spice cake mix
  • 1 14.5 oz. can pumpkin puree
  • 2 eggs
  • ¼ cup oil
  • ¾ cup chocolate chips
  • ¾ cup chopped walnuts

Instructions

  • Preheat the oven to 350 degrees.
  • Prepare the loaf pan by spraying it well with non-stick coating, set aside.
  • Lightly chop the nuts.
  • Pour the ingredients into a large mixing bowl and mix by hand until just combined. Pour into the prepared loaf pan.
  • Bake at 350 for 45 minutes
